Linux 拨号vps windows公众号手机端

AAA服务器:认证、授权与计费的关键

lewis 1年前 (2024-07-01) 阅读数 755 #VPS/云服务器

在网络世界中,AAA服务器是确保网络安全、管理用户访问权限以及跟踪资源使用情况的重要组件。AAA代表认证(Authentication)、授权(Authorization)和计费(Accounting),这三个过程构成了网络管理的基石。本文将探讨AAA服务器的功能及其重要性。

认证(Authentication)

认证是确认用户身份的过程,确保只有合法用户可以访问网络资源。AAA服务器通过多种方法进行认证,包括:

  • 用户名和密码:最常见的认证方式,用户必须输入正确的用户名和密码才能获得访问权限。
  • 数字证书:使用公钥基础设施(PKI)来验证用户身份,通常用于企业级安全环境。
  • 双因素认证:结合密码与其他身份验证方法,如智能卡、生物识别或一次性密码。

授权(Authorization)

一旦用户通过认证,AAA服务器接下来会确定用户可以访问哪些资源和服务。授权策略可以基于用户的角色、组别或预定义的权限设置。例如:

  • 角色基础访问控制(RBAC):根据用户的职责分配访问权限。
  • 访问控制列表(ACL):定义哪些用户或组可以访问特定资源。

计费(Accounting)

计费涉及跟踪用户对网络资源的使用情况,以便进行审计、计费或容量规划。AAA服务器记录以下信息:

  • 会话开始和结束时间:监控用户活动的持续时间。
  • 数据使用量:测量传输的数据量,对于按流量收费的服务尤为重要。
  • 服务类型:记录用户访问了哪些服务,如VPN、Wi-Fi等。

AAA服务器的应用

AAA服务器广泛应用于各种网络环境中,包括:

  • 企业网络:保护敏感数据,确保员工根据其角色访问相应资源。
  • 服务提供商:为宽带、移动数据和其他通信服务提供用户认证和计费。
  • 云服务:管理多租户环境下的用户访问和资源使用情况。

结论

AAA服务器是现代网络架构中不可或缺的一部分,它们确保了网络的安全性和可管理性。随着网络攻击的日益复杂,强大的AAA机制变得更加重要。通过实施有效的认证、授权和计费策略,组织可以保护自己的资产,同时为用户提供无缝的网络体验。

版权声明

本文仅代表作者观点,不代表米安网络立场。

发表评论:

◎欢迎参与讨论,请在这里发表您的看法、交流您的观点。

热门